Huge Sea Turtle Crashes Wedding

It had been years since the last time we saw Leatherback sea turtles come to Cabo, and since November, we have had three of them on different beaches laying their eggs. Over a dozen baby sea turtles have been born, and we expect more very soon. In the meantime, a 500 kilos (over 1,100 lbs) Leatherback crashed a wedding at Villas del Mar in Palmilla at 11:00 pm. Security personnel was there to secure the area and make sure nobody bothered her while she laid 67 eggs. Only the groom and bride, Jacobo Batarse and Maria Simon were allowed to get a tad nearer for the photo opp.
